Transaction 3db1614165dd333de92e892cb29349c86f1de377a55a697162a190b27e59f426
1 Input
1 Output
-
3db1614165dd333de92e892cb29349c86f1de377a55a697162a190b27e59f426:0
- value
- 26434855
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b31261cd9e5fbb864e30f8f9b23ff22c17d4419
- address
- ltc1q9vcjv8xeuhamse8rp78ekgllytqh63qeg6n4lt